Baseball: Playoff push will be furious in 8-6A; 7-3A on final week

By Jeff Hart Sports Reporter

The 2024 regular season will come to a close this week, and while nine northeast Georgia area teams already have punched their playoff tickets across the eight Georgia High School Association classifications, there are still plenty of teams on the proverbial bubble.

The is plenty of drama left in Region 8-6A, where four area teams are among six fighting for a playoff spot. Apalachee (16-10, 11-2 Region 8-6A) still holds a one-half game lead over North Forsyth (18-9, 12-3 Region 8-6A) for first place. Habersham Central (17-7, 9-6 Region 8-6A) leads Gainesville (11-12, 8-8 Region 8-6A) by 1 1/2 games and the Red Elephants lead Jackson County (9-16, 5-9 Region 8-6A) by 1 1/2 games for the final playoff spot.

Habersham Central needs just one win to clinch no worse than third place and the Red Elephants need just one win to clinch a playoff spot. Gainesville can claim the third spot if it wins out and Habersham drops its final three games this week.

Region 7-3A still has some work to do overall but No. 2 Pickens (24-3, 17-1 Region 7-3A) has completed its region schedule and also has clinched the region title. Wesleyan (13-11, 9-6 Region 7-3A), Dawson County (14-9, 8-7 Region 7-3A), Gilmer (12-13, 6-9 Region 7-3A), Lumpkin County (12-14, 6-9 Region 7-3A), and White County (13-14, 5-10 Region 7-3A) are all still alive for the other three playoff spots.

All five of those teams are in action this week in three game series. Gilmer takes on West Hall beginning on Monday. Wesleyan and Lumpkin County open a series in Dahlonega and White County and Dawson County begin their series in Dawsonville on Tuesday.

Region 8-4A has concluded its regular season schedule and will hold its three play-in series beginning on Tuesday. Cherokee Bluff is the only area school assured of a playoff spot as the Bears clinched the North subregion and will play Seckinger in a three-game series for the No. 1 seed. North Hall and East Forsyth also will be involved in three-game series to get into the state playoffs.
